I've noticed some bumps on the shaft of my penis and I think I've got an ingrown hair too. I'm really not sure what's going on. What do you think I should do about this?

For bumps on the penis shaft and ingrown hairs, try gentle exfoliation with a warm washcloth, avoid tight clothing, and use a gentle shaving cream or trimmer to reduce hair ingrowth; apply topical creams like hydrocortisone or tea tree oil to soothe inflammation, and consider consulting a dermatologist or urologist to rule out underlying conditions like folliculitis, keratosis pilaris, or genital warts.

I'm thinking about using Skinlite cream for just a week, and I'm a bit worried. Can using it for only seven days cause any harm? Would love your advice.

Using Skinlite cream, which contains hydroquinone, for only 7 days is unlikely to cause significant harm, but it's essential to follow the recommended usage and consult a dermatologist, as prolonged or excessive use can lead to skin darkening, irritation, or other adverse effects.
